Signs You May Need AC Replacement in Murrieta
Many homeowners are unsure whether they should repair an older unit again or start planning for a full replacement. If your current system struggles to keep up during the hottest afternoons in Murrieta or seems to run nonstop without reaching your thermostat setting, it may no longer be the right fit for your home. Paying attention to these patterns early can help you budget and choose a new system on your schedule instead of during an emergency breakdown.
Common warning signs include rising electric bills from one summer to the next, frequent repair visits, or uncomfortable rooms even after service. You might also notice loud operation, short cycling, or musty odors that return soon after a repair. When several of these issues show up together on a system that is already 10 to 15 years old, it often makes more financial sense to invest in an air conditioning replacement Murrieta families can rely on for long-term comfort.

Our AC Installation Process
Knowing what to expect on installation day can make the process much less stressful. We start by confirming system sizing and placement, taking into account local building codes and any community guidelines that apply to homes in Murrieta. Before any work begins, we protect flooring and nearby surfaces so the job can be completed cleanly and with minimal disruption to your daily routine.
Once preparation is complete, we safely disconnect the existing equipment, set the new indoor and outdoor components, and complete all necessary refrigerant and electrical connections. We check airflow, drain lines, and thermostat communication, then run the system through cooling cycles to make sure it operates the way it should in real Murrieta heat. Throughout the appointment, we are available to answer questions so you always know what step comes next and how long the process will take.
After installation, we review basic maintenance tasks such as filter changes, discuss any warranty documentation, and go over recommended tune-up schedules for our desert-influenced climate. Frequently Asked Questions
How Long Does a Typical AC Installation Take?
Most standard residential AC installations can usually be completed in a single day, although more complex projects may take longer. Factors that affect timing include the size of the system, whether ductwork needs adjustments, and the accessibility of equipment areas. During our in-home visit, we provide a realistic time frame so you can plan around work, school, and other commitments.
What Size Air Conditioner Do I Need for My Murrieta Home?
System size depends on more than just square footage. We look at insulation levels, window quality, ceiling height, and sun exposure, which are all important in the warm Murrieta climate. A properly sized unit will cool efficiently without short cycling or running constantly, helping control utility costs and reduce wear on components.
Should I Replace My Furnace at the Same Time as My AC?
Replacing both pieces of equipment together is not always required, but it can be beneficial if the furnace is the same age as the AC or has a history of problems. Matching indoor and outdoor components helps improve efficiency and may simplify future service. We review the condition of both systems with you so you can decide whether a combined project fits your budget and long-term plans.
